How they compare
Naoero currently reports 4.0% against 3.9% in Portugal,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 20 times across 55 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Naoero ahead.
Naoero ranks 86th and Portugal ranks 87th of 214 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Naoero averaged higher in 4 and Portugal in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Naoero | Portugal |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 10.4% | 15.8% | 5.4% | Portugal |
| 1980s | 8.4% | 18.2% | 9.8% | Portugal |
| 1990s | 7.6% | 6.6% | 1.0% | Naoero |
| 2000s | 7.8% | 2.9% | 4.9% | Naoero |
| 2010s | 5.3% | 1.2% | 4.1% | Naoero |
| 2020s | 5.9% | 4.3% | 1.6% | Naoero |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Inflation as measured by the annual growth rate of the GDP implicit deflator shows the rate of price change in the economy as a whole. The GDP implicit deflator is the ratio of GDP in current local currency to GDP in constant local currency.
